首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在laravel中连接多个表

在 Laravel 中连接多个表可以通过使用 Eloquent ORM 提供的关联关系来实现。关联关系允许我们在不同的数据库表之间建立关联,以便在查询数据时能够方便地获取相关联的数据。

在 Laravel 中,有多种类型的关联关系可供选择,包括一对一关联、一对多关联、多对多关联等。下面是一些常见的关联关系及其使用方法:

  1. 一对一关联:
    • 概念:一对一关联表示两个表之间的一对一关系,其中一个表的每个记录只能关联另一个表的一个记录。
    • 优势:可以方便地通过模型对象访问关联的数据。
    • 应用场景:例如,用户表和个人资料表之间可以建立一对一关联,以便在查询用户信息时能够同时获取用户的个人资料信息。
    • 示例代码:
    • 示例代码:
    • 推荐的腾讯云相关产品:无
  • 一对多关联:
    • 概念:一对多关联表示一个表的记录可以关联另一个表的多个记录。
    • 优势:可以方便地通过模型对象访问关联的数据,并支持关联数据的增删改查操作。
    • 应用场景:例如,文章表和评论表之间可以建立一对多关联,以便在查询文章信息时能够同时获取文章的评论信息。
    • 示例代码:
    • 示例代码:
    • 推荐的腾讯云相关产品:无
  • 多对多关联:
    • 概念:多对多关联表示两个表之间的多对多关系,其中一个表的每个记录可以关联另一个表的多个记录,反之亦然。
    • 优势:可以方便地通过模型对象访问关联的数据,并支持关联数据的增删改查操作。
    • 应用场景:例如,用户表和角色表之间可以建立多对多关联,以便在查询用户信息时能够同时获取用户的角色信息。
    • 示例代码:
    • 示例代码:
    • 推荐的腾讯云相关产品:无

以上是在 Laravel 中连接多个表的常见方法和示例代码。通过使用这些关联关系,我们可以轻松地在 Laravel 应用程序中处理多个表之间的数据关联。更多关于 Laravel 的数据库操作和关联关系的详细信息,请参考 Laravel 文档

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

34分48秒

104-MySQL目录结构与表在文件系统中的表示

1分58秒

腾讯千帆河洛场景连接-维格表&企微自动发起审批配置教程

1分37秒

腾讯千帆河洛场景连接-自动发送短信教程

6分5秒

etl engine cdc模式使用场景 输出大宽表

338
22分13秒

JDBC教程-01-JDBC课程的目录结构介绍【动力节点】

6分37秒

JDBC教程-05-JDBC编程六步的概述【动力节点】

7分57秒

JDBC教程-07-执行sql与释放资源【动力节点】

6分0秒

JDBC教程-09-类加载的方式注册驱动【动力节点】

25分56秒

JDBC教程-11-处理查询结果集【动力节点】

19分26秒

JDBC教程-13-回顾JDBC【动力节点】

15分33秒

JDBC教程-16-使用PowerDesigner工具进行物理建模【动力节点】

7分54秒

JDBC教程-18-登录方法的实现【动力节点】

领券